What is the relationship between photosynthesis and cellular respiration

Biology
1 answer:
tatiyna3 years ago
7 0
The relationship between the two - Cellular Respiration depends on photosynthesis because photosynthesis makes oxygen.
Photosynthesis depends on Cellular respiration because cellular respiration releases carbon dioxide. This is the relationship between the two.

Low iodide status during the first trimester of pregnancy may lead to
erastova [34]
The answer would be cretinism

Iodine is an element that vital for making thyroid hormone. Deficiency of iodine can cause hypothyroidism which can lead to growth retar..dation of the child inside the mother. This will cause the child develop a disease called cretinism. A child with cretinism will have a disturbance in growth and development.

In your own words, explain what natural selection is?
Katyanochek1 [597]

Answer:

Natural selection is the process of which forms of life having traits that better enable them to adapt to specific environmental pressures, such as predators, changes in climate, or even competition for food or mates. As the species will tend to survive and reproduce in greater numbers than others of their kind, thus ensuring the perpetuation of those favorable traits in succeeding generations.
